Innovative Technology:

At the heart of the 2ZZ-GE’s prowess lies its innovative Variable Valve Timing and Lift intelligent (VVTL-i) system. This groundbreaking technology allows for dynamic control over valve timing and lift, optimizing performance across the engine’s RPM range. Unlike conventional engines, the 2ZZ-GE boasts a dual camshaft profile system, enabling seamless transitions between low and high cam profiles for enhanced power delivery without the need for forced induction.

Exceptional Performance:

With a displacement of 1.8 liters and a compression ratio of 11.5:1, the 2ZZ-GE delivers a potent combination of power and efficiency. In its naturally aspirated guise, it churns out an impressive 164 to 190 horsepower, while supercharged variants push the boundaries further, unleashing an exhilarating 220 to 260 horsepower. Torque figures are equally impressive, ranging from 170 to 180 Nm for atmospheric versions and 215 to 235 Nm for supercharged iterations.

Legendary Applications:

Throughout its production run, the 2ZZ-GE found its way into a diverse array of vehicles, each benefiting from its potent performance and technological sophistication. From the Toyota Celica GT-S to the Lotus Elise and Exige, this engine powered some of the most beloved sports cars of its era. Its versatility extended to different markets, with variants tailored to meet the demands of enthusiasts worldwide.

Challenges and Solutions:

While revered for its performance, the 2ZZ-GE is not without its challenges. Common issues such as oil burn, timing chain-related noises, and throttle instability have been reported, particularly as the engine surpasses the 150,000-kilometer mark. However, proactive maintenance and addressing known issues promptly can mitigate these concerns, ensuring the longevity and performance of this legendary powerplant.

Legacy and Recognition:

The legacy of the Toyota 2ZZ-GE extends beyond its impressive specifications and applications. Recognized for its exceptional power output per liter and high-revving nature, it earned the prestigious International Engine of the Year award in 2002, solidifying its status as one of the most remarkable mass-produced engines of its time.
